Davido & 30BG Family When you think of influential celebrity cliques in Nigeria, it’s almost impossible not to start with Davido’s 30BG crew (30 Billion Gang). Over the years, Davido has built a strong inner circle that includes his manager, Asa Asika; nightlife mogul Cubana Chief Priest; loyal aide Israel DMW; and other DMW associates who move with him for shows, weddings and tours. In 2025, that bond showed up publicly again at Asa Asika’s lavish traditional wedding, where reports described “Davido’s inner circle” turning up in full force, complete with other 30BG members and close friends. Moments like Israel DMW’s surprise birthday celebration, where Cubana Chief Priest and Davido teamed up to honour him, also show how this group positions itself as more than just colleagues. Don Jazzy & The Mavin Family If there’s any crew that openly calls itself a family, it’s the Mavins family. Mavin Records was founded by Don Jazzy in 2012 after the end of Mo’ Hits, and it has grown into one of Africa’s biggest labels. This label has included, or currently includes, Rema, Ayra Starr, Ladipoe, Johnny Drille, Crayon, Magixx, Boy Spyce, Bayanni, Lifesize Teddy, and DJ Big N, and they are often described collectively as the “Mavin Records family”. Don Jazzy constantly promotes his artists by joking with them online and dancing to their songs. This reinforces that “big uncle” energy. This label has done all-star projects, group photoshoots and anniversary concerts that showcase how close-knit the team is. Funke Akindele & Eniola Badmus: Nollywood Best-friends In Nollywood, the Funke Akindele and Eniola Badmus friendship has been one of the most talked-about and loved for years. Even in 2025, their bond is still trending. A recent report described how Funke visited Abuja to promote her new movie Behind The Scenes, and Eniola jumped in with playful banter over who should cook amala, leaving fans admiring their friendship energy. Pulse and other platforms have previously referred to them as besties, highlighting how long and publicly supportive their friendship has been. Waje & Omawumi: Music Sisters Turned Business Partners The Waje and Omawumi friendship is another classic example of a deep, long-term connection in Nigerian entertainment. Over the years, multiple interviews and features have described them as best friends and “sisters,” noting that they attend events together, share wins, and have been close for over a decade. In 2019, Omawumi told Punch that they even launched an entertainment outfit together; meanwhile, Waje has explained how their company, Hermanes Media, formalised the business side of their long-standing partnership. They also co-produced and starred in the film She Is, blending friendship, film, and music into one project. Their bond has survived industry pressure, rumours and career ups and downs. Adesua Etomi & Linda Ejiofor: On the younger side of Nollywood, Adesua Etomi and Linda Ejiofor’s relationship has given fans some of the sweetest BFF moments. When Linda got married in 2018, Adesua was her maid of honour; wedding coverage described them as “best friends” and highlighted how Adesua serenaded Linda as she walked down the aisle, with both of them in stunning bridal-style dresses. Like many friendships, they’ve had quiet ups and downs. There were reports of a “silent beef” and later, news of reconciliation during Ini Dima-Okojie’s wedding in 2022, where they were spotted together again. Later on, blogs reported Adesua celebrating Linda online again, describing her as her best friend in loving posts.
